In Re: CAN 3 of 2019 Ms. Das, learned counsel appearing on behalf of the applicant/petitioner submits that she does not wish to proceed with the application, being CAN 3 of 2019.
In such view of the matter, let CAN 3 of 2019 be dismissed as not pressed.
In Re: CAN 5 of 2022 This is an application for condonation of delay of 1105 days in filing the restoration application, being CAN 4 of 2022.
Perused the grounds. Such grounds are found to be sufficient.
In the circumstances, CAN 5 of 2022 is allowed and CAN 4 of 2022 is taken on board.
In Re: CAN 4 of 2022 This is an application for restoration of WPA 1792 of 2018. The said writ petition was dismissed for default by an order dated December 6, 2018 passed by a Coordinate Bench of this Hon'ble Court. Perused the grounds. Such grounds are found to be sufficient.
Let the order dated December 6, 2018 be recalled and WPA 1792 of 2018 be taken on board. CAN 4 of 2022 is allowed.
The said application for restoration is allowed only upon payment of costs assessed at Rs.2,000/- payable to the learned advocate appearing on behalf of the respondents by 2 weeks from date. In default, the writ petition will stand dismissed.
